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
521540 3441085477 45541345415 323697074 15233
85566 93765 4787033
85566 93765 4787033
694218271 10 33
All about undefined
Interested in learning more?
85566 93765 4787033
694218271 10 33
See more
0824630 70081593866 643
1070 96189699531 204
See more
944004507 57002852
35875566695 8790 120994661 69083
See more